Kovacs Budha Tamas is one of Budapest's first generation of conceptual graffiti artists who have taken their form beyond juvenile street scrawling. Sometimes compared to Keith Haring, he studied at the Budapest Art Academy and was one of the featured artists on Hungarian MTV and mucsarnok joint venture film series “pixel portraits” to introduce young visual artists to a broader audience.
In addition to painting, he has also worked on the films Vakondok and Moleman3 which is a documentary diary about a journey from the Budapest underground to the cultural surface. His paintings have been exhibited at the Ludwig Museum and the Budapest Art Factory.
